Transaction 28362ae60f23528ecc7a85f2591f11e438d5ac785aaeda47a5e6072899676ac3

1 Input
2 Outputs
  • 28362ae60f23528ecc7a85f2591f11e438d5ac785aaeda47a5e6072899676ac3:0
  • value  525580
    address  3Dxv5gomtUBpwbK61ko7cVM1c2pc8Dsxc5
  • 28362ae60f23528ecc7a85f2591f11e438d5ac785aaeda47a5e6072899676ac3:1
  • value  1621394
    address  13wpd3VfV8YmTdWVgdy57n3sxRiK7e7ZT1